Understanding the Ingredients

Creating the perfect Frozen Yogurt Apple Crumble Coins starts with understanding the key ingredients that make this dessert not only tasty but also nutritious. Let’s dive into the primary components of this recipe.

Apples: The star of the show, apples, bring both flavor and nutrition to the table. Known for their high fiber content and vitamin C, apples are a fantastic choice for a healthy dessert. When selecting apples for this recipe, consider using varieties like Granny Smith for their tartness or Honeycrisp for their sweetness. Both types provide a lovely contrast to the creamy yogurt and are excellent for baking, as they hold their shape well during the freezing process.

Spices: Cinnamon plays a crucial role in this recipe, enhancing the flavors of the apples while adding warmth and depth. Beyond its delightful taste, cinnamon also boasts several health benefits, including anti-inflammatory properties and blood sugar regulation. A sprinkle of cinnamon not only elevates the dish but also contributes to its overall health profile.

Sweetening Options: When it comes to sweetening your yogurt and apple mixture, you have choices between natural sweeteners like honey and maple syrup. Honey offers a floral sweetness and a hint of complexity, while maple syrup adds a rich, earthy note. Both options bring their own unique flavors to the dish, so feel free to choose based on your taste preferences or dietary needs.

Oats and Almond Flour: For the crumble topping, oats and almond flour are excellent choices that provide both texture and nutrition. Oats are a great source of fiber and can help keep you feeling full, while almond flour is a gluten-free alternative that adds a nutty flavor and additional protein to the crumble. This combination not only enhances the taste but also makes the dessert suitable for those with gluten sensitivities.

Butter vs. Coconut Oil: When it comes to binding the crumble topping, you can choose between traditional butter and coconut oil. While butter provides a classic flavor and richness, coconut oil offers a dairy-free alternative that can be used for a vegan version of the dessert. Both fats contribute to the desired crumbly texture, so select based on your dietary preferences.

Yogurt: The yogurt is essential to this recipe, serving as the creamy base that ties everything together. You can opt for plain yogurt, which allows the flavors of the apples and spices to shine, or flavored yogurt for an extra layer of taste. Greek yogurt is another excellent choice, as it is thicker and creamier, contributing to a more indulgent texture while packing in protein.

Step-by-Step Instructions

Now that we understand the ingredients, let’s break down the preparation process for the Frozen Yogurt Apple Crumble Coins. This step-by-step guide will ensure clarity and ease as you embark on creating this delightful dessert.

1. Preparing the Apples:

Start by washing and peeling your chosen apples. After peeling, core and slice the apples into thin, even pieces. To enhance the flavor, marinate the apple slices in a mixture of cinnamon and your chosen sweetener. Allow them to sit for about 15-20 minutes; this step is crucial as it helps to draw out moisture and intensify the sweetness of the apples, creating a more flavorful filling.

2. Crafting the Crumble Mixture:

While the apples are marinating, you can prepare the crumble topping. In a mixing bowl, combine oats, almond flour, a pinch of salt, and your choice of sweetener. Mix these dry ingredients thoroughly before adding your butter or coconut oil. Use your fingers or a pastry cutter to combine the mixture until it resembles coarse crumbs. The goal is to achieve a texture that is both crumbly and cohesive, so don’t be afraid to get your hands in there!

3. Layering the Ingredients:

Once your apples are marinated and your crumble is ready, it’s time to assemble the dessert. Start by evenly distributing a layer of the marinated apples in a muffin tin or silicone mold. This ensures that each coin has a generous amount of apple filling. Next, sprinkle the crumble mixture over the apples, making sure to cover them completely for that perfect crunchy topping. This layering process not only creates a beautiful presentation but also ensures that every bite is balanced with flavors and textures.

4. Adding Yogurt:

The final step before freezing is to add the yogurt. Spoon a layer of your chosen yogurt over the crumble topping, ensuring that it is evenly spread. For a fun twist, consider mixing in flavor enhancements like vanilla extract, a dash of nutmeg, or even a swirl of fruit puree into the yogurt before adding it. This not only adds flavor complexity but also allows for creativity in your dessert.

Frozen Yogurt Apple Crumble Coins

Ingredients

2 large apples (such as Granny Smith or Honeycrisp), peeled and diced

1 teaspoon cinnamon

2 tablespoons honey or maple syrup

1 cup rolled oats

1/2 cup almond flour

1/3 cup brown sugar

1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ted (or coconut oil for a vegan version)

1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ract

2 cups plain or flavored yogurt (Greek works great)

Optional toppings: chopped nuts, shredded coconut, or chocolate chips

Instructions

Prepare the Apples: In a medium bowl, combine the diced apples, cinnamon, and honey (or maple syrup). Mix well to coat all the apples evenly. Set aside to marinate for about 10 minutes.

    Make the Crumble Mixture: In another bowl, mix the rolled oats, almond flour, brown sugar, and melted butter (or coconut oil) until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.

      Layer the Ingredients: Line a muffin tin with cupcake liners or lightly grease the cups. Spoon a layer of the apple mixture (about 1 tablespoon) into each cup, followed by a layer of the crumble mixture to evenly cover the apples.

        Add Yogurt: Spoon the yogurt on top of the crumble layer until each cup is filled to the brim. If desired, swirl in some extra honey or sprinkle additional cinnamon for enhanced flavor.

          Freeze: Place the muffin tin in the freezer and freeze for at least 4 hours or until solid.

            Serve: Once the Frozen Yogurt Apple Crumble Coins are fully frozen, remove them from the muffin tin by pulling on the cupcake liners. If they stick, run warm water over the bottom of the tin for a few seconds.

              Garnish (optional): Top each coin with chopped nuts, coconut, or chocolate chips for an extra crunch before serving. Enjoy your delightful, frozen treats!

                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 20 minutes | 4 hours | 12 servings
